United Kingdom Student Visa
Complete guide to studying in United Kingdom. Get detailed information about requirements, fees, and the application process.
📋 Required Documents
- Valid passport
-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ies (CAS) number
- Proof of financial means
- Academic Technology Approval Scheme (ATAS) certificate (if required)
- English proficiency test results (if required)
⏱️ Processing Time
Varies by country, typically 3-4 weeks.
Average processing time for student visa applications
💰 Visa Fees
GBP 490 (base application fee).
Current student visa application fee
💼 Work During Study
Part-time work for up to 20 hours per week during term time and full-time during vacations for most higher education students.
🏛️ Immigration Authority
UK Visas and Immigration (UKVI)
🔗 Official Links
📝 Eligibility Summary
Confirmation of Acceptance for Studies (CAS) from a licensed student sponsor, proof of sufficient funds for tuition and living costs, and a valid passport.
📅 Visa Validity
Issued for the duration of the course.
🎓 Post-Study Options
Graduates can apply for the Graduate visa to stay and work in the UK for two years (three years for PhD graduates) after completing their studies.
🏠 Path to Permanent Residency
The Graduate visa can be a pathway to a skilled worker visa, which can lead to indefinite leave to remain (ILR) after five years.
